Output e4c64ecda618c372708013120b0ce6a56e13f73fee81b78b6d5aa729e41c488a:1

value
25763431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d4113dd667f1c9b1459ecc3e78600d4a3fbf4a OP_EQUAL
address
MBMBHE3VXWc23phFsqj3BQgWhUTxvuwpw4
transaction
e4c64ecda618c372708013120b0ce6a56e13f73fee81b78b6d5aa729e41c488a
spent
true